Job Description
Learning and Development Associate supporting training and onboarding at Charlie Health for the Care Experience team. Leading virtual sessions and enhancing onboarding materials.
Responsibilities:
- Lead engaging, high-impact virtual training sessions for new hires on the Care Experience team, ensuring alignment with role-specific workflows and expectations
- Design, implement, and continuously refine asynchronous onboarding materials (e.g., e-learning modules, job aids, knowledge bases) that support scalable, effective learning
- Strategically evaluate and improve onboarding programs through data analysis, stakeholder feedback, and collaboration with cross-functional teams
- Partner with leadership and subject matter experts to ensure onboarding content reflects current best practices, business needs, and departmental priorities
- Maintain and enhance onboarding documentation, including training manuals and internal resources, to ensure accuracy and relevance
- Support long-term learning initiatives by identifying skill gaps and contributing to ongoing training programs for existing team members
- Work with key stakeholders to ensure strategies support business objectives and mission across departments
- Act as a Salesforce super user, providing training, support, and consultation for new and tenured teammates
Requirements:
- 2+ years of experience in behavioral health or healthcare in a client-facing setting, OR in Learning & Development, training, or enablement
- Proven ability to design and deliver engaging live and asynchronous training experiences, including slide decks, e-learning modules, and job aids
- Strong facilitation skills with comfort leading virtual training sessions and workshops for diverse learner audiences
- Highly proficient in Salesforce, Zoom, and Google Workspace (Slides, Docs, Sheets); LMS experience is strongly preferred
- Bachelor's degree in a related field preferred
- Excellent interpersonal and relationship-building skills with the ability to collaborate cross-functionally and influence without authority
- Exceptional project management, organization, and time management skills, with the ability to prioritize and execute in a fast-moving environment
